Boo Carter is a key prospect out of Tennessee for the class of 2024. On Tuesday, he made cuts to his list of potential destinations.
A 4-star ATH, Carter kept Ohio State and Michigan in the mix on his list. Colorado, Oregon and Tennessee rounded out the rest of Carter’s list.

Listed at 5-foot-10 and 184 pounds, Carter has made plays on both sides of the ball as a running back and defensive back. According to the 247 Sports Composite Rankings, Carter rates as the No. 32 ATH in the country and 5th overall player out of Tennessee for the class of 2024.
